Serving 583 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Eleanor Roosevelt Elementary School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Pennsylvania for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 68% (which is hig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 69% (which is hig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 55%).
The student-teacher ratio of 13:1 is equal to the Pennsylvania state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 31% of the student body (majority Black and Asian), which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 40% (majority Hispanic and Black).

School Overview
Eleanor Roosevelt Elementary School's student population of 583 students has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 46 teachers has declined by 6% over five school years.
